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Sydenham (London) to Morchard Road start from as little as £20.60

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Sydenham (London) to Morchard Road start from £115.20 one way, or £116.20 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Sydenham (London) to Morchard Road are available for £149.50 one way, or £299.00 return

Facilities and Amenities

Sydenham (London) station is equipped with various amenities to enhance your travel experience. For ticket purchasing, it offers an operational ticket office open from early morning to the evening on weekdays and Saturdays, with more limited hours on Sundays. Furthermore, ticket machines are available for those who prefer self-service, ensuring you can collect tickets purchased online conveniently at any time.

While the station aims to accommodate all passengers, please note the B2 accessibility status. Step-free access is available at specific locations, with some platform interchanges requiring a short street journey. The station has accessible ticket machines and induction loops to help those with hearing impairments.

Even though there are no toilets or baby changing facilities, you can enjoy a decent cup of coffee while waiting for your train. Bicycle racks are available for those who prefer to bike to the station, and CCTV ensures security across the premises. Additionally, friendly staff are ready to assist you during manned hours, and customer help points are strategically placed across the station.

Facilities and Amenities

Morchard Road station is humble in its amenities, embodying the simplicity of the rural setting it serves. Unfortunately, there is no ticket office or machines for ticket collection, so travelers are advised to purchase their tickets in advance or online. Accessibility is a strong point, with step-free access across the station, making it a convenient choice for travelers with mobility needs. A seating area is available, though you won't find waiting rooms or toilets here. Cycling enthusiasts can safely park their bikes, as spaces for bicycle storage are available on the platform.

Accessibility and Support

Despite its small size, Morchard Road station ensures that accessibility is prioritized, with step-free access available throughout. Although there are no dedicated accessible parking spaces or staff assistance, help points provide support to travelers. You can enjoy peace of mind with assistance bookings via Passenger Assist, accommodating your travel needs with confidence.
